Oct. 30, 1979-Oct. 30, 1980: Recording sessions for the album "Somewhere In England" take place. The first finished version of the album is rejected, with the cover and four songs -- "Lay His Head," "Flying Hour," "Sat Singing" and "Tears of the World" -- replaced. One of the replacement songs, "Blood From a Clone," criticizes his record company for changing the album.
